Western Security Plan for Ukraine Rejected by Moscow: Analysis and Reactions

Moscow's outright rejection of a Western-backed security plan for Ukraine has sent shockwaves through international relations, sparking a flurry of analysis and strong reactions from across the globe. The proposed plan, details of which remain partially undisclosed, aimed to provide long-term security guarantees for Ukraine following the ongoing conflict. However, Russia's vehement dismissal underscores the deep chasm in perspectives and the significant hurdles to achieving lasting peace.

This decisive rejection highlights the complexities of negotiating with Russia, particularly considering its ongoing aggression and annexation of Ukrainian territory. The international community now faces the daunting task of reassessing its approach to the conflict and finding a path forward that addresses Ukraine's security concerns while acknowledging Russia's stated objections.

Key Points of the Rejected Plan (Where Available)

While the specifics remain largely confidential, leaked information suggests the plan included:

  • Long-term security guarantees: These would likely have involved commitments from NATO or other Western powers to assist Ukraine in the event of future aggression. This could have included military aid, training, and intelligence sharing.
  • Arms supplies and military assistance: Continued and potentially increased provision of weaponry and training to the Ukrainian military would have been a central component.
  • Economic support: Significant economic aid to help Ukraine rebuild its infrastructure and economy after the war was likely included.
  • International monitoring mechanisms: The plan might have included provisions for international monitoring of the situation to ensure compliance with any agreements reached.

These proposals, however, were deemed unacceptable by Moscow.

Russia's Rationale and Reactions

Russia's official statement cited several reasons for its rejection, including:

  • Violation of its security interests: Moscow consistently frames NATO expansion and Western support for Ukraine as direct threats to its national security. The proposed plan was likely seen as a further encroachment on these interests.
  • Unilateral nature of the plan: Russia likely objects to the plan's perceived lack of meaningful input from Moscow during its formulation. They demand a more inclusive and equitable process.
  • Lack of commitment to neutrality: Russia’s long-standing demand for Ukraine to remain neutral is a central point of contention, and the proposed plan likely did not adequately address this.

The Kremlin's response has been swift and uncompromising, with pronouncements reiterating Russia's commitment to its stated goals in Ukraine and warnings of further escalation if its concerns are not addressed.

International Reactions and Next Steps

The rejection has drawn condemnation from many Western nations, who view it as a sign of Russia's unwillingness to engage in meaningful negotiations for a peaceful resolution. NATO allies have reiterated their commitment to supporting Ukraine, while simultaneously grappling with the implications of Moscow's hardline stance.

The path forward remains uncertain. The international community is now faced with several key questions:

  • How will Ukraine adapt its security strategy? Ukraine will need to re-evaluate its defense strategy and seek alternative means of securing its long-term safety.
  • What are the next steps for Western powers? Continued support for Ukraine is likely, but the approach may need to be reassessed in light of Russia's rejection. Increased diplomatic efforts, while challenging, may be necessary.
  • What are the prospects for a negotiated settlement? The prospects for a negotiated settlement appear increasingly dim given Russia's uncompromising position.

The rejection of the Western security plan marks a significant turning point in the conflict. The international community must now carefully consider its options and develop a coherent strategy to address the complex challenges presented by this critical juncture.
